Every effective EV charger installation begins well before any tools are unpacked or cables are run, with a thorough examination of the property's existing electrical system carried out by a certified electrician. Sydney's real estate stock is extremely varied, ranging from Federation-era homes in the inner west with outdated single-phase switchboards to freshly constructed townhouses in the northwest corridor fitted with modern three-phase power supplies. This diversity suggests that no two EV charger installation tasks equal, and what suits one property might be completely unsuitable for another. A qualified installer will inspect the switchboard, evaluate the available electrical capability, assess the cable routing options between the board and the designated charger place, and recognize any compliance requirements that must be addressed before work can continue. Where a switchboard is found to be inadequate for the additional load, an upgrade will be advised, and whilst this adds to the upfront financial investment, it significantly improves the overall security and performance of the home's whole electrical system.

Selecting the ideal charger unit is a decision that significantly forms the long-lasting value and functionality of your EV charger installation, and it is not one that should be made based upon rate alone. The most commonly suggested choice for residential properties throughout Sydney is a hardwired Level 2 air conditioning charger, typically rated at 7.2 kilowatts on a 32-amp circuit, which can bring back a complete charge to most modern-day electrical vehicles in six to 10 hours depending upon battery capacity. Smart battery chargers, which connect via Wi-Fi or Bluetooth and can be scheduled through a smartphone application, are increasingly popular due to the fact that they enable house owners to programme charging during off-peak tariff periods, decreasing electrical power expenses visibly gradually. Some models likewise incorporate perfectly with home solar systems, instantly prioritising solar-generated energy when it is readily available and only drawing from the grid when required. Talking about these choices in detail with your EV charger installation service provider guarantees the system chosen is genuinely matched to your car, your energy setup, and your way of life rather than simply being the design the installer has in stock.

Compliance website and accreditation are non-negotiable aspects of any EV charger installation carried out in New South Wales, and house owners must beware of any tradesperson who downplays their importance. All electrical work in the state need to stick to AS/NZS 3000 circuitry guidelines, and the setting up electrician is legally obligated to offer a certificate of compliance upon completing the job. In the wider Australian regulative context, this certification works as formal proof that the installation was performed safely and to the required requirement, which is important for home insurance coverage purposes and any future property deals. Strata and apartment or condo residents in Sydney deal with an additional layer of intricacy, as approval from the owners corporation need to usually be obtained before an EV charger installation can proceed within common home locations such as basement parking lot. Navigating this approval procedure is something experienced installers can typically assist with, and it is far much better attended to proactively than found as an obstacle after contracts have actually been signed.
